Queen rocks Rod Laver like it’s 1978

ADAM Lambert may well have the toughest job in modern music — fronting Queen. But the American singer brings his own personality and vocal prowess to the gig, rather than merely doing karaoke Freddie Mercury.

How Ed Sheeran conquered Oz

In 2011 Ed Sheeran was playing to a handful of media in Collingwood and sang one song on a table. This month he’ll play to 250,000 people in Melbourne alone on the most successful tour in Australian history. Here’s how it happened
